RAPID PROTOTYPING

A family of fabrication processes developed to make engineering prototypes in minimum lead time based on a CAD model of the item. Traditional method is machining require significant lead-times – several weeks, depending on part complexity and difficulty in ordering materials .Rapid Prototyping allows a part to be made in hours or days, given that a computer model of the part has been generated on a CAD system.

STEP-1Solid Modelling and TessellationSurfaces of the CAD model are tessellated and the STL file is exported. Tessellation is the piecewise approximation of the surfaces of CAD model using series of triangles. STEP-2SlicingAfter selecting part deposition orientation, tessellated model is sliced. STEP -3Deposition of LayersVarious technologies for layer deposition are used:Liquid Based : StereolithographyPowder Based : Selective Laser SinteringSolid Based : Fused Deposition Modelling STEP-4Post ProcessingPost curingRemoval of support structureFinishing by sanding, polishing or painting

Impact on Cost, Quality and Time The direct impact of a shorter product development time includes the opportunity to sell the product at premium prices early in the life cycle, and enjoy longer market life cycle. In addition the benefits include faster breakeven on development investment and lower financial risk, which leads to greater overall profits and higher return on investment (ROI).

Working PrincipleIt works on the principle of layering down materials in layers, a plastic filament or metal wire is unwound from a coil and supplies material to produce a part.
